On the author [from Online Archive of California and other public domain sources]: Zalmen Zylbercweig a.k.a. Zilbertsvayg (1894-1972) was born in Chortkov, Galicia. He started his career as an actor before he turned to writing, translating, and directing plays. Zylbercweig was a historian of the Yiddish Theater.  His best known work was his Leksikon fun yidishn teater (Lexicon of the Yiddish Theatre), a six volume reference work in Yiddish on the lives of those who were involved in professional Yiddish Theater anywhere in the world. Zylbercweig relocated to New York in 1937 where he served as editor for the Jewish American for eleven years. He later moved to Los Angeles.
